Hinano Nagasaki's "Silvery First Scenery (Orchestra Version)" is a sweeping ballad that captures fleeting summer memories and luminous moments through the grandeur of orchestral sound. With imagery of wind chimes, shimmering heat haze, and changing skies, the song preserves the fragile yet unforgettable vision of a "once-in-a-lifetime first scenery."

The recurring lines "A once-in-a-lifetime first scenery, swaying and sparkling" and "So that in the end, we can smile" reflect both a longing to cherish limited time and a determination to etch irreplaceable memories into the heart. Enhanced by the orchestral arrangement, the track gains even greater depth and emotional power, amplifying the delicacy and transience of the original version.

As summer blue turns to silver, and laughter marks the turning of seasons, the song evokes universal moments of youth that resonate with listeners' own memories.

"Silvery First Scenery (Orchestra Version)" embraces the beauty of passing seasons and the irretrievability of time. Hinano Nagasaki's pure, luminous voice, intertwined with majestic orchestral arrangements, leaves a profound and lasting impression on the heart.

Artist Profile

  • Hinano Nagasaki

    8月6日生まれ。 埼玉県出身。 とにかく唄うことが大好き。 幼少期の家庭環境や小学生の時にいじめを受けたりで学校に行けなかった時音楽に救われ、歌手になりたいという気持ちが芽ばえる。 音楽の影響を受けたのはJanne Da Arc、Acid Black Cherry。 18歳の時『ONE OK ROCK18祭 1000人の奇跡 We are』(2017年1月にNHKにて放映)に出演し、そこで田中雪子氏に出逢って以降Skoop On Somebody、山崎育三郎、コブクロなど有名アーティストのコーラスにも参加するようになる。 武道館を目指し、毎日が一期一会を胸に掲げ日々奮闘中。
